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ll send a team of experts to assess the damage and create a customized plan to dry and restore your property. This includes identifying the source of the water damage and developing a strategy to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use industrial-strength pumps and vacuums to extract water from your property. This includes removing standing water, drying walls and floors, and cleaning and disinfecting affected areas.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property, including air movers, dehumidifiers, and drying mats. This helps to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Restoration
We’ll clean and restore your property, including walls, floors, and ceilings. This includes removing any remaining water, drying and disinfecting surfaces, and applying specialized coatings to prevent future damage.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Quality Control
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is dry and free of any remaining water damage. We’ll also perform quality control checks to ensure that our work meets the highest standards.

Warning Signs You Need Retail Store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ong musty odors can show the presence of mold and mildew growth. If you notice a persistent smell in your store, it’s time to call in the experts.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Water stains can be a sign of water damage or leaks. If you notice any water stains, it’s essential to investigate further and take action quickly.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show that your store has experienced water damage. If you notice any damage to your flooring, it’s time to call in the experts.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or leaks. If you notice any damage to your paint or wallpaper, it’s essential to investigate further and take action quickly.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ks can be a sign of a more significant problem. If you notice any water leaks, it’s time to call in the experts and get them fixed before they cause further damage.
Discoloration or Staining on Furniture or Fixtures
Discoloration or staining on furniture or fixtures can show that your store has experienced water damage. If you notice any damage to your furniture or fixtures, it’s time to call in the experts.
Retail Store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a corner of the store | Yes | No | You can likely fix it yourself with some basic plumbing knowledge. |
| Large area of water damage or flooding | No | Yes | This needs specialized equipment and expertise to dry and restore the area safely and effectively. |
| Musty odors or mold growth | No | Yes | This needs specialized equipment and expertise to remove and prevent further mold growth. |
| Water damage to critical infrastructure (e.g. Electrical systems) | No | Yes | This needs specialized expertise to repair and restore safely and effectively. |
| Water damage to high-value items (e.g. Electronics, furniture) | No | Yes | This needs specialized expertise to restore and preserve safely and effectively. |
| Uncertainty about the extent of the damage | No | Yes | This needs a professional assessment to find out the best course of action. |

Retail Store Water Damage Restoration Cost In Culver City, CA
The cost of retail store water damage restoration can vary widely depending on the severity and scope of the damage. Here are some estimated costs for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ed |
| Cleaning and rest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ials affected, and level of damage |
| Equipment rental and setup |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and rental duration |
| Disinfection and decontamination |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ials affected, and level of contamination |
| Structural repairs and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ials affected, and level of damage |
| Final inspection and quality control | $500 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and level of damage |
Keep in mind that these are just estimates, and the actual cost of retail store water damage restoration may be higher or lower depending on your specific situation.

Common Questions About Retail Store Water Damage Restoration
Q: What is the average cost of retail store water damage restoration?
A: The average cost of retail store water damage restoration can vary widely depending on the severity and scope of the damage. But, on average, you can expect to pay between $1,000 and $5,000 for basic services, and up to $10,000 or more for more extensive repairs.
Q: How long does retail store water damage restoration take?
A: The length of time it takes to complete retail store water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ity and scope of the damage. But, on average, you can expect the process to take anywhere from a few days to several weeks.
Q: What is the most common cause of retail store water damage?
A: The most common cause of retail store water damage is a burst pipe or leaky faucet. This can be caused by a variety of factors, including age, wear and tear, and poor maintenance.
Q: Can I do retail store water damage restoration myself?
A: While it may be possible to do some minor repairs yourself, it’s generally not recommended to try major repairs or restoration without the help of a professional. This can lead to further damage, safety hazards, and costly mistakes.
Q: What is the best way to prevent retail store water damage?
A: The best way to prevent retail store water damage is to stay on top of maintenance and repairs, and to address any issues quickly. This includes checking pipes and fixtures regularly, fixing leaks quickly, and keeping an eye out for signs of water damage.
